Check out the advice it has there; examine yourself in the shower every now and then for any changes in your testicles (the wiki article has some of the symptoms you could find, such as lumps or hardness on one testicle). If you find anything unusual, get down to the doctor and get it checked out.

If it's really bothering you, I think it would do you good to go and get checked out by your GP anway. Getting the all-clear will give you peace of mind. I don't think there's too much to worry about at your age though. Ultimately, it's better to be safe than sorry, so a quick check-up with your GP won't hurt.
